Nice! I do it all the time at estate sales. The sewing machines are always the last to go. So wait til the last day, hunt out the ones that have lots of attachments and the original manuals, clean them up and sell them on eBay! I generally make $50-100 each! Want my big tip? Advertise the older ones as "Heavy duty" and put a picture of a few layers of denim that you've stitched. When I started doing that, I added $20-50 of profit to every machine! And it's not false advertising-it's GOOD advertising!
